Description
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in H-Sphere 2.5.1 Beta 1 and earlier all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via the (1) next_template, (2) start, (3) curr_menu_id, and (4) arid parameters in psoft/servlet/resadmin/psoft.hsphere.CP when using the mailman/massmail.html template_name.
